In the lecture, the speaker states that the painting pointed in the text is real work of Rembrandt although all the arguments in the text are true.
First, inconsistency in the dressing was true but she explaines that fur was added to the original painting 100 years after the time of painting. This will explains the inconsistency in the clothing. She believes that somebody years after the original painting added the fur to increases the value of the painting by looking like aristocracy state.Therefore, the first reason in the text has its explanation.
Moreover, the text claims that Rembrandt was master of light and shade and the painting does not show this skill. The professor points out that the added fur is the reason of this discrepancy and when the fur removed from the painting the light color cloth in the neck does not make any shadow in the face. Consequently, the argument provided is not the reason of painting being fake.
Lastly, in the passage author claimes that the back of painting is not the same of other work of Ramberdt. The lecturer describes that the pannel of wooded glued together added after the fur was added to the original painting. The original painting was in simple wood from same tree that was used in other works of Rambertd. In fact, adding the fur and enlarging the back was performed later to make the painting grand and invaluable by someone else. As a result, the original painting indeed is Ramberdt work.
